AD3 Axient Digital Plug-On Transmitter

The Shure AD3 plugs onto any microphone to transmit wireless audio to compatible Axient Digital AD4D and AD4Q receivers. Supporting both conventional AA and Shure SB900-series rechargeable battery options, the AD3 features a lightweight, rugged, metal chassis that resists sweat, moisture, and debris.

AD3 Transmitter Overview

① Display

View menu screens and settings. Press any control button to activate the backlight.

② Infrared (IR) port

Align with the receiver IR port during an IR Sync for automated transmitter tuning and setup.

③ Control buttons

Use to navigate through parameter menus and to change settings.

④ Power switch

Hold the X button to power the unit on or off.

⑤ Enter button

Press to enter menu screens and confirm menu changes.

⑥ Power LED

  • Green = Unit is powered on
  • Red = Low battery, or battery error

⑦ Audio LED

Red, yellow, and green LEDs indicate average and peak audio levels.

The LED will turn red when the limiter is engaged.

⑧ USB-C port

Supplies power or charges Shure rechargeable battery. LED indicates charging status when connected to a power supply.

  • Red = Charging
  • Green = Full charge
  • Yellow = Not charging

⑨ Battery compartment

Requires two AA batteries or Shure rechargeable battery.

⑩AA battery adapter

Use to secure AA batteries. Remove when using a Shure rechargeable battery.

⑪ XLR connector

Connection point for wired microphones, cables, and boom poles, among other things.

⑫ Locking ring

To release the XLR connector, turn the ring counterclockwise and push in.

⑬ Pouch

Provides additional grip and protection for the transmitter.

⑭ Belt clip

Holds transmitter and microphone securely for hands-free carrying.

Setup

  1. Open the battery door to install the batteries.
    • AA batteries: Use the AA adapter as shown below. Important: Set the AA battery type for more accurate readings.
    • Shure rechargeable battery: Remove the AA adapter.

  2. Press and hold X to turn on the transmitter.
  3. Select the appropriate input pad or boost to avoid overloading the audio input our add boost to low-output sources: Audio > Pad
    • -12 dB: Use with high output sources, such as line levels and point-to-point applications.
    • Off (default): Use with typical microphones.
    • +12 dB: Use with low output sources.

Setting the AA Battery Type

If using an AA battery, set the battery type for more accurate readings.

  1. Navigate to Utilities and select Battery.
  2. Use the ▼▲ buttons to select the installed battery type:
    • Alkaline = Alkaline
    • NiMH = Nickel Metal Hydride
    • Lithium = Lithium Primary
  3. Press O to save.

Power Over USB

When not using batteries, power the transmitter through the USB C port on the bottom of the unit.

The USB port can simultaneously power the transmitter and charge Shure rechargeable batteries.

Transmitter Controls

X Hold to power on and off or exit a menu without saving changes.
O Enter menu or save changes.
∨∧ Scroll menus and parameter values.

Tip: Hold the button while powering on to enter safe start mode.

Locking the Interface

Lock transmitter interface controls to prevent accidental or unauthorized changes to parameters. The lock icon appears on the home screen when a lock is enabled.

  1. Use the Utilities > Locks menu and choose from the following options:
    • None: The controls are unlocked
    • Power: The power switch is locked
    • Menu: The menu parameters are locked
    • All: The power switch and menu parameters are locked
  2. Press O to save.

Tip: To quickly unlock the transmitter menu, press O and select None.

IR Sync

Use IR Sync to form an audio channel between the transmitter and receiver.

Note: The receiver band must match the band of the transmitter.

  1. Select a receiver channel.
  2. Tune the channel to an available frequency using group scan or manually turn to an open frequency.
  3. Power on the transmitter.
  4. Press the SYNC button on the receiver.
  5. Align the IR windows between the transmitter and the receiver so that the IR LED illuminates red. When complete, Sync Success! appears. The transmitter and receiver are now tuned to the same frequency.

Note: Any change to the encryption status on the receiver (enabling/disabling encryption) requires a sync to send the settings to the transmitter. New encryption keys for the transmitter and receiver channel are generated on every IR sync, so to request a new key for a transmitter, perform an IR sync with the desired receiver channel.
